大约有 40,000 项符合查询结果(耗时:0.0605秒) [XML]
StackOverflow程序员推荐:每个程序员都应读的30本书 - 杂谈 - 清泛网 - 专...
...也可以看看阮一峰的读后感。)
19. 《Peopleware / 人件集:人性化的软件开发》
Demarco 和 Lister 表明,软件开发中的首要问题是人,并非技术。他们的答案并不简单,只是令人难以置信的成功。第二版新增加了八章内容。 – Edua...
成功熬了四年还没死?一个IT屌丝创业者的深刻反思 - 资讯 - 清泛网 - 专注C...
...他可以掀起一场养猪行业的革命。使得20年后才会出现的人性、高效、开放、协作、健康的养殖方式提前到达。
在这场革命中,他会活的非常有价值。
这种价值,在原先的圈子里,是完全体验不到的。因为他此前的所有工...
转型产品经理必看 - 更多技术 - 清泛网 - 专注C/C++及内核技术
...领域的产品经理们,奉为经典。张小龙,微信之父,深谙人性,理解潮流,能把一款产品做到人们的生活中,几亿人都为之买单,实属境界。相信每一个产品经理都有改变世界的梦想,也都在这条不归路上螨跚前行,改变世界的...
Uber5岁了,一次性告诉你它的商业之道 - 资讯 - 清泛网 - 专注C/C++及内核技术
...率为4倍。他公布了手机截图,众多网友随后指责Uber“没人性”,Uber的回应是:调高价格是为了鼓励司机上线,从该地区接走更多乘客。
不过,Uber很快调整了危机时刻的溢价策略。2015年初,墨西哥城一家医院发生爆炸事故,...
Win32汇编--使用MASM - C/C++ - 清泛网 - 专注C/C++及内核技术
...,把好好的一个系统搞得像接力赛跑一样。
对于这些弱点,程序员们都有个愿望:系统功能如果能以功能名作为子程序名直接调用就好了,参数也最好定义的有意义一点,这样一来写程序就会方便得多,编系统扩展模块也就...
廉价共享存储解决方案1-drbd+ha+nfs - 更多技术 - 清泛网 - 专注C/C++及内核技术
...缓存的情况下可能会报目录不存在的错误,无视
yum clean all
yum makecache
3安装drbd(share1和2上操作)
3.1 准备编译环境
yum -y install gcc make automake autoconf flex rpm-build kernel-devel
3.2 上传解压源文件
利用xftp 把 drbd-8.4.6.tar.gz,d...
vs2008编译boost详细步骤 - 开源 & Github - 清泛网 - 专注C/C++及内核技术
...t --without-python --build-type=complete link=shared threading=multi install
(2)只编译 release 版本 regex 动态库,包括头文件和库文件
bjam --toolset=msvc-9.0 --prefix=D:\05_Computer\04_3rdPatry\02Boost\boost_1_44_0\output1 --with-regex link=shared threading=multi variant=rel...
REDHAT 6.4 X64下ORACLE 11GR2静默安装 - 数据库(内核) - 清泛网 - 专注C/C++及内核技术
...可能会报目录不存在的错误,无视
[root@redhat ~]#yum clean all
[root@redhat ~]#yum makecache
检查一下成功没有
[root@redhat mnt]# yum grouplist
6、安装支持包
[root@redhat yum.repos.d]# cd /mnt/
[root@redhat mnt]# cat pacakage.txt
[root@redhat mnt]# yum install $(...
Boost.Asio的简单使用(Timer,Thread,Io_service类) - C/C++ - 清泛网 - 专注C/C++及内核技术
... asio::write(socket, asio::buffer(message),
asio::transfer_all(), asio::ignore_error());
}
}
最后处理异常
catch (std::exception& e)
{
std::cerr << e.what() << std::endl;
}
return 0;
运行示例:运行服务器,然后运行上一节的客户端,在win...
google mock分享(全网最全最好的gmock文档,没有之一) - C/C++ - 清泛网 ...
... string value = "Hello World!";
MockFoo mockFoo;
EXPECT_CALL(mockFoo, getArbitraryString()).Times(1).
WillOnce(Return(value));
string returnValue = mockFoo.getArbitraryString();
cout << "Returned Value: " << returnValue << endl;
return...